HELP International School (commonly known as HIS) is an international school founded in 2014[citation needed] in Malaysia's Klang Valley. It is located in Shah Alam, Selangor.[1]

The school opened its doors to its first students in 2014 and its founding principal was Gerard Louis. Louis left the school at the end of 2014 and was replaced by Davina McCarthy. The school has since grown to around 1,000 students (as of 2016). In 2019 the recent principal is Martin Van Rijswijk. The school has 5 floors some of the facilities can include the indoor swimming pool, the table tennis room, the grass area, the football range and the large amounts of PE rooms. the school costs about 10,000 RM per year. Help international school has reached 5-stars for the evaluation of educational quality. In addition, HIS is also an approved provider of the Duke of Edinburgh's international award.
